(src *PermissionsConfig)
| 320 | } |
| 321 | |
| 322 | func clonePermissionsConfig(src *PermissionsConfig) *PermissionsConfig { |
| 323 | if src == nil { |
| 324 | return nil |
| 325 | } |
| 326 | return &PermissionsConfig{ |
| 327 | Allow: cloneStringSlice(src.Allow), |
| 328 | Ask: cloneStringSlice(src.Ask), |
| 329 | Deny: cloneStringSlice(src.Deny), |
| 330 | } |
| 331 | } |
| 332 | |
| 333 | func cloneStringMap(src map[string]string) map[string]string { |
| 334 | if len(src) == 0 { |
no test coverage detected